A couple of things I find useful here: I am a deep believer in assuming good faith. Patience, assuming good faith and time are often the most effective solution to many contentious situations. And my wise brother once told me it is rude to point out another's rudeness. This is an extreme version of comment on content, not on the contributor. "Correcting" a user's manners is often fueling the fire. It is rare that several people leading by example doesn't eventually calm things down.
